> With this setup you have no single point of failure, and even if the
> connection to internet fails, they can still provide time as they are peering
> and synchronizing with each other. 

No, it doesn't work that way.  You need connectivity to at least one stratum 1 
server.

There is an option to elect one, orphan mode, if you get disconnected from the 
net.  That keeps all the local clocks close together.  They will all drift 
along with the chosen leader.

> server time.nist.gov

That's a bad example.  NIST has servers at several locations.  That name 
rotates across them.  You might get a good one, or you might get one on the 
other side of the country.  If it works well today, it may not after you 
reboot and pick a different server.

> just a cheap GPS receiver (serial is best, but USB should be OK

There are 3 levels of GPS receiver.  GPSDO is best.  GPS with PPS is second - serial prefered, but USB works.  Low cost GPS (without PPS) on USB is last.

USB is polled -- no interrupts.  That adds a millisecond of jitter.  That's probably not an issue if your goal is 100 ms.  (If you are a geek, be sure you understand hanging bridges.)

The timing on the serial port from low cost GPS receivers is often crappy.  This is a horrible example:
  http://users.megapathdsl.net/~hmurray/ntp/GPSSiRF-off.gif
Anyway, you need to check the device you select.  (Or get suggestions from people who are using them for NTP.)

The PPS signal will fix that.

The GPSDO will continue providing decent time if your GPS stops working.  Holdover is the buzzword.
